    Common Types of Sign Up Bonuses

    There are several main categories of sign up bonuses that you’ll encounter at online casinos:

    • Matched Deposit Bonus: The casino matches your first deposit by a certain percentage, up to a specified limit. For example, A 100% match up to £100 means depositing £100 will give you an extra £100 to play with.
    • No Deposit Bonus: A smaller bonus awarded simply for registering, without requiring a deposit. These are less common but highly sought after.
    • Free Spins: A set number of spins on selected slot games, either as part of a deposit offer or a no-deposit bonus.
    • Combined Offers: Many casinos bundle matched deposits with free spins for a more attractive package.

    Each type of bonus has its own advantages and drawbacks, particularly when it comes to wagering requirements and game restrictions.

    How Sign Up Bonuses Work

    The process of claiming a sign up bonus is generally straightforward, but there are important details to consider:

    • Registration: Create an account at your chosen casino and verify your identity, usually by providing proof of address and ID.
    • Claiming the Bonus: Some bonuses are credited automatically, while others require a bonus code or opting in during registration or deposit.
    • Making a Deposit: For matched deposit bonuses, you’ll need to fund your account with a qualifying amount. Always check the minimum deposit required to trigger the bonus.
    • Wagering Requirements: Most bonuses come with terms that require you to wager the bonus amount (or winnings from free spins) a certain number of times before you can withdraw any associated winnings.
    • Game Restrictions: Not all games contribute equally to wagering requirements. Slots typically contribute 100%, while table games and live dealer games often count for less.

    Understanding these mechanics will help you make the most of your bonus and avoid common pitfalls.

    Key Terms and Conditions to Watch For

    Before claiming any sign up bonus, it’s essential to read the terms and conditions carefully. Here are some of the most important factors to consider:

    • Wagering Requirements: This is the number of times you must play through the bonus (and sometimes deposit) before withdrawing winnings. Lower requirements are generally more favourable.
    • Maximum Winnings: Some bonuses cap the amount you can win from the bonus funds or free spins.
    • Time Limits: Bonuses and free spins are often only valid for a limited period after activation, such as 7 or 30 days.
    • Eligible Games: Bonuses may be restricted to certain slots or game categories.
    • Payment Method Restrictions: Some payment methods, like Skrill or Neteller, may not qualify for the bonus.

    Carefully reviewing these terms can help you avoid disappointment or forfeiting your bonus.
